Author: davsclaus Date: Thu Apr 2 09:38:16 2009 New Revision: 761216 URL: http://svn.apache.org/viewvc?rev=761216&view=rev Log: Using requestBody for InOut instead of sendBody.
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/ConvertPayloadToInputStreamT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pClientRouteT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pGetT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pRouteT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yContentBasedRouteT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amAsExchangeHeaderT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yResponseBodyWhenErrorT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ettySteveIssueTest.java cam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yWithXPathChoiceTest.java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/ConvertPayloadToInputStreamT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/ConvertPayloadToInputStreamT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/ConvertPayloadToInputStreamT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/ConvertPayloadToInputStreamTest.java Thu Apr 2 09:38:16 2009 @@ -40,7 +40,7 @@ MockEndpoint mockEndpoint = getMockEndpoint("mock:result"); mockEndpoint.expectedMessageCount(1); - template.sendBodyAndHeader("http://localhost:9080/test", expectedBody, "Content-Type", "application/xml"); + template.requestBodyAndHeader("http://localhost:9080/test", expectedBody, "Content-Type", "application/xml"); mockEndpoint.assertIsSatisfied(); List<Exchange> list = mockEndpoint.getReceivedExchanges();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pClientRouteT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pClientRouteT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pClientRouteT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pClientRouteTest.java Thu Apr 2 09:38:16 2009 @@ -46,7 +46,7 @@ MockEndpoint mockEndpoint = getMockEndpoint("mock:a"); mockEndpoint.expectedBodiesReceived("<b>Hello World</b>"); - template.sendBodyAndHeader("direct:start", new ByteArrayInputStream("This is a test".getBytes()), "Content-Type", "application/xml"); + template.requestBodyAndHeader("direct:start", new ByteArrayInputStream("This is a test".getBytes()), "Content-Type", "application/xml"); mockEndpoint.assertIsSatisfied(); List<Exchange> list = mockEndpoint.getReceivedExchanges(); @@ -68,11 +68,9 @@ public void configure() { errorHandler(noErrorHandler()); Processor clientProc = new Processor() { - - public void process(Exchange exchange) throws Exception { + public void process(Exchange exchange) throws Exception { InputStream is = (InputStream) exchange.getIn().getBody(); } - }; from("direct:start").to("http://localhost:9080/hello").process(clientProc).intercept(new StreamCachingInterceptor()).convertBodyTo(String.class).to("mock:a"); @@ -80,7 +78,6 @@ Processor proc = new Processor() { public void process(Exchange exchange) throws Exception { ByteArrayInputStream bis = new ByteArrayInputStream("<b>Hello World</b>".getBytes()); - exchange.getOut(true).setBody(bis); } };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pGetT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pGetT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pGetT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pGetTest.java Thu Apr 2 09:38:16 2009 @@ -35,7 +35,7 @@ MockEndpoint mockEndpoint = resolveMandatoryEndpoint("mock:results", MockEndpoint.class); mockEndpoint.expectedMessageCount(1); - template.sendBody("direct:start", null); + template.requestBody("direct:start", null, Object.class); mockEndpoint.assertIsSatisfied(); List<Exchange> list = mockEndpoint.getReceivedExchanges();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pRouteT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pRouteT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pRouteT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/HttpRouteTest.java Thu Apr 2 09:38:16 2009 @@ -75,7 +75,7 @@ } protected void invokeHttpEndpoint() throws IOException { - template.sendBodyAndHeader("http://localhost:9080/test", expectedBody, "Content-Type", "application/xml"); + template.requestBodyAndHeader("http://localhost:9080/test", expectedBody, "Content-Type", "application/xml"); } @Override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yContentBasedRouteT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yContentBasedRouteT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yContentBasedRouteT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yContentBasedRouteTest.java Thu Apr 2 09:38:16 2009 @@ -32,7 +32,7 @@ mock.expectedHeaderReceived("one", "true"); - template.sendBody(serverUri + "?one=true", null); + template.requestBody(serverUri + "?one=true", null, Object.class); assertMockEndpointsSatisfied(); } @@ -42,7 +42,7 @@ mock.expectedHeaderReceived("two", "true"); - template.sendBody(serverUri + "?two=true", null); + template.requestBody(serverUri + "?two=true", null, Object.class); assertMockEndpointsSatisfied(); }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amAsExchangeHeaderT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amAsExchangeHeaderT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amAsExchangeHeaderT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amAsExchangeHeaderTest.java Thu Apr 2 09:38:16 2009 @@ -34,7 +34,7 @@ mock.expectedHeaderReceived("two", "twei"); mock.expectedHeaderReceived(HttpConstants.HTTP_METHOD, "GET"); - template.sendBody(serverUri + "?one=einz&two=twei", null); + template.requestBody(serverUri + "?one=einz&two=twei", null, Object.class); assertMockEndpointsSatisfied(); } @@ -45,7 +45,7 @@ mock.expectedHeaderReceived("two", "dos"); mock.expectedHeaderReceived(HttpConstants.HTTP_METHOD, "GET"); - template.sendBodyAndHeader(serverUri, null, HttpConstants.HTTP_QUERY, "one=uno&two=dos"); + template.requestBodyAndHeader(serverUri, null, HttpConstants.HTTP_QUERY, "one=uno&two=dos"); assertMockEndpointsSatisfied(); } @@ -55,7 +55,7 @@ mock.expectedBodiesReceived("Hello World"); mock.expectedHeaderReceived(HttpConstants.HTTP_METHOD, "POST"); - template.sendBody(serverUri, "Hello World"); + template.requestBody(serverUri, "Hello World"); assertMockEndpointsSatisfied(); }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yHttpGetWithParamTest.java Thu Apr 2 09:38:16 2009 @@ -39,7 +39,7 @@ mock.expectedHeaderReceived("one", "einz"); mock.expectedHeaderReceived("two", "twei"); - template.sendBody(serverUri + "?one=uno&two=dos", "Hello World"); + template.requestBody(serverUri + "?one=uno&two=dos", "Hello World"); assertMockEndpointsSatisfied(); } @@ -50,7 +50,7 @@ mock.expectedHeaderReceived("one", "einz"); mock.expectedHeaderReceived("two", "twei"); - template.sendBodyAndHeader(serverUri, "Hello World", HttpConstants.HTTP_QUERY, "one=uno&two=dos"); + template.requestBodyAndHeader(serverUri, "Hello World", HttpConstants.HTTP_QUERY, "one=uno&two=dos"); assertMockEndpointsSatisfied(); }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yResponseBodyWhenErrorT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yResponseBodyWhenErrorT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yResponseBodyWhenErrorT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yResponseBodyWhenErrorTest.java Thu Apr 2 09:38:16 2009 @@ -30,7 +30,7 @@ public void testResponseBodyWhenError() throws Exception { try { - template.sendBody("http://localhost:9080/myapp/myservice", "bookid=123"); + template.requestBody("http://localhost:9080/myapp/myservice", "bookid=123"); fail("Should have thrown an exception"); } catch (RuntimeCamelException e) { HttpOperationFailedException cause = (HttpOperationFailedException) e.getCause();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ettySteveIssueT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ettySteveIssueT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ettySteveIssueT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ettySteveIssueTest.java Thu Apr 2 09:38:16 2009 @@ -32,7 +32,7 @@ mock.expectedBodiesReceived("<html><body>foo</body></html>"); mock.expectedHeaderReceived("x", "foo"); - template.sendBody(serverUri + "?x=foo", null); + template.requestBody(serverUri + "?x=foo", null, Object.class); assertMockEndpointsSatisfied(); } Modified: cam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yWithXPathChoiceTest.java URL: http://svn.apache.org/viewvc/cam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yWithXPathChoiceTest.java?rev=761216&r1=761215&r2=761216&view=diff ============================================================================== --- cam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yWithXPathChoiceTest.java (original) +++ camel/trunk/components/camel-jetty/src/test/java/org/apache/camel/component/jetty/JettyWithXPathChoiceTest.java Thu Apr 2 09:38:16 2009 @@ -62,6 +62,8 @@ protected RouteBuilder createRouteBuilder() { return new RouteBuilder() { public void configure() { + errorHandler(deadLetterChannel("mock:error").delay(0)); + // Need a convertBodyTo processor here or we may get an error // that we are at the end of the stream from("jetty:http://localhost:9080/myworld").choice()